“Estuarine mapping” The approach overall is based on three key aspects of working with #complex systems and #organizationaldevelopment :

🌟 Initiating and monitoring micro-nudges, lots of small projects rather than one big project, so that success and failure are both (non-ironically) opportunities.

🌟 Understanding where we are and starting journeys with a sense of direction rather than abstract goals.

🌟 Understanding and working with propensities and dispositions, managing both so that the things you desire have a lower energy cost than the things you don’t.

It also embodies the principles of the “Vector Theory of Change”. Estuarine mapping also allows us to reduce conflict around #decisionmaking in environments with multiple, strong viewpoints on what should be done.
